Sally's mosaic exhibition, 'Piecing It Together', is open to the public and runs from 3rd September until 20th October at Alchemist Gallery, Dingwall. It is a tribute to the enduring life force of nature in the face of climate change; breaking, reusing and reassembling into something whole, a powerful expression of resilience and strength out of fragility.
